As many you asked, what is the difference between a liberal arts college and a university? Educational advisers note that liberal arts colleges generally differ from National Universities by focusing solely on undergraduates – often offering few or no graduate programs – allowing more flexibility in the curriculum, and emphasizing teaching that prioritizes a broad base of knowledge over professional training …

What is not a liberal arts college?

Examples of non-liberal arts educations include law school, medical school, engineering programs, and architecture programs. Architecture may be considered a form of art – it just doesn’t fall under the heading of liberal arts.

What is considered a liberal arts college?

What Is a Liberal Arts College? While many colleges and universities grant liberal arts degrees, a liberal arts college offers a focused liberal arts education. These colleges generally emphasize small class sizes and a curriculum centered on the humanities, arts, social sciences, and natural sciences.
